摘    要:针对现阶段通用滗水器的不足,开发了一种新型的无动力滗水器,对其工作原理、结构设计组成、技术参数的计算进行了说明,同时介绍了该设备的设计注意事项。新型无动力滗水器在工程应用中进行了测试,并加以改进,设备运行稳定、良好。

Abstract:In order to avoid the shortcomings of current decanters, a new unpowered decanter was developed. Its working principle, structure design and technical parameter calculation were explained, and the matters to which attention should be paid in its design were introduced. The unpowered decanter was tested and improved during the engineering project application. The equipment operation is stable and better.
